Abstract
The best synthesis conditions for (1-x)TeO2 + xBaO and (1-x)TeO2 + xBa F2 glasses of high and reproducible quality have been established, and their glassy region determined. Te L(III)-edge XANES (X-ray absorptio n near edge structures), Te L(III) and K-edge EXAFS (extended X-ray ab sorption fine structure) experiments were used to characterize the gla ssy network of these Ba-modified tellurite glasses. Addition of barium has been shown to induce a depolymerization of the TeO2 framework (br eaking of some Te-(ax)O(eq)-Te bridges), leading to partial transforma tion of TeO4+2E sites into TeO3+1E sites.
